"I haven't played any tough character yet"- Govinda
You
have
been
for
a
long
time
now
in
Bollywood.
Which
were
your
best
days
of
your
professional
career?
Starting
from
Shola
Aur
Shabnam
to
1997
released
film
Bade
Miya
Chote
Miya,
was
the
best
period
of
my
life
as
during
that
period
I
did
some
good
roles
and
that
too
with
innocence.
Now
too
the
innocence
in
visible
in
the
roles
you
play.
How
do
you
manage
to
treasure
that
innocence?
As
one
takes
care
of
his/her
house
so
that
it
looks
attractive
to
him/her
as
well
as
others.
Likewise
one
should
also
make
sure
to
regularly
clean
his/her
mind
thinking
of
Saraswati
Maata.
I
also
do
the
same
thing.
Now-a-days
you
are
known
to
divert
your
attention
more
towards
spiritualism;
any
special
reason
behind
it?
I
am
moving
towards
spiritualism
due
to
my
mother.
For
the
start,
I
was
very
hot-tempered
and
had
to
indulge
in
fights.
But
once
I
got
inspired
by
my
mother's
teachings
and
became
her
student,
life
changed
for
me.
I
learnt
a
lot
of
good
things
from
my
mother.
At
the
same
time
I
learnt
that
those
who
are
hot
tempered
get
to
meet
people
who
are
much
more
hot
tempered
than
him/her.
At
the
start
of
your
career
you
portrayed
a
lot
of
serious
characters.
But
since
around
ten
years
you
are
mostly
seen
in
comedy
flicks.
Why?
Frankly
speaking,
I
was
tired
of
portraying
serious
roles.
I
started
working
in
the
industry
when
I
was
21
years
old.
Before
that,
since
I
was
fourteen
I
have
to
help
my
mother
in
household
works
like,
sweeping,
washing
clothes,
etc.
I
have
worked
a
lot
throughout
my
life.
Due
to
this
I
started
going
through
a
lot
of
stress
and
comedy
brought
a
new
freshness
in
my
life.
How
do
you
manage
a
brilliant
timing
in
comedy
with
your
co-stars
which
off
course
is
a
very
important
aspect
in
comedy?
See,
in
comedy
more
than
an
actor,
a
director
has
to
be
good
in
his
work.
If
the
director
is
good
then
you
can
even
succeed
in
doing
a
comedy
act
with
a
lamppost.
